Serena, the goddess who can read minds, is falling in love with the one person in the world she shouldn't be. Stanton is a Follower, a child of the Atrox. He is evil, she is good, can the relationship make it through the perils and end up changing Stanton for the good? Or will it be Serena who takes the plunge into the darkside? Cant tell you, you have to read this wonderful book. I loved the way the book kept me in suspense, I liked the way that it had that Romeo and Juliet meets Buffy the Vampire Slayer (except without the vampires...or the slayer...). I recommend this book to everyone.
